Fullwood, Executive Director MEMORANDUM TO: John Dorney Water Quality Planning FROM: Richard B. Hamilton Assistant Director DATE: February 10, 1993 SUBJECT: 401 Water Quality Certification for Greenville Utilities Commission, SR 1401 Water Treatment Plant, Greenville, Pitt County, North Carolina. We have reviewed the subject permit application and biologists on our staff are familiar with habitat values of the project area. An on-site investigation was conducted on January 26, 1993 for the purpose of assessing construction impacts to wildlife and fisheries resources. Our comments are provided in accordance with provisions of the Fish and Wildlife Coordination Act (48 Stat. 401, as amended; 16 U.S.C. 661 et. seq.). The applicant, Greenville Utilities Commission, proposes to decant excess water from an alum sludge lagoon at its water treatment plant through a 6 in. discharge pipe into the Tar River. The pipe is to be buried through approximately 100 ft. of river flood plain wetlands vegetated with river birch, ironwood and cypress (numerous cypress knees). The wetlands have a well established root mat that contains the soil and prevents erosion. On February 2, 1993 the site was revisited with the plant engineer. The engineer stated the ditch would be excavated 2 ft. wide by approximately 2 ft. deep with a tracked hydraulic backhoe. We are concerned that the ditch cannot be effectively backfilled and stabilized with vegetation due to the erosive forces of frequent flooding, the ditch being located on the outside of a sharp bend in the river. We therefore request the project be modified in the following manner: suspend the discharge pipe a minimum of 1 ft. above the floor of the flood plain and extend the discharging end well out into the river so the effluent stream will not erode the bank. If the modification cannot be carried out, we recommend that certification be denied. Thank you for the opportunity to review and comment on this application. Langley, Water Treatment Plant Superintendent Post Office Box 1847 Greenville, North Carolina 27835-1847 Dear Mr. Langley: Please reference your December 8, 1992 meeting with Mrs. Laura Fogo of my staff, at the Greenville Water Treatment Plant located off S.R. 1401, adjacent to the Tar River, Greenville, Pitt County, North Carolina. Also in attendance were Messrs. Bud Greer and Wayne Meads, of the Greenville Utilities Commission. The purpose of this meeting was to discuss your plans to install a 6-inch pvc pipe from the alum sludge disposal lagoon to the Tar River for the purpose of discharging water into the river. On April 1, 1988, we renewed general permit no. 198100049, (copy enclosed) that authorizes the maintenance, repair and installation of aerial and subaqueous utility lines with attendant structures and the discharge of excavated or fill materials, within construction/access corridors, associated with utility line maintenance, repair and installation in navigable waters and waters of the United States in the State of North Carolina. For the purposes of the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ers'. Regulatory Program, Title 33, Code of Federal Regulations (CFR), Part 330.6, published in the Federal Register on November 22, 1991, lists nationwide permits. Authorization, pursuant to Section 10 of the Rivers and Harbors Act and Section 404 of the Clean Water Act, was provided for construction of outfall structures and associated intake structures where the effluent from the outfall is authorized, conditionally authorized, or specifically exempted, or is otherwise in compliance with regulations issued under the National Pollutant Discharge Elimination System (NPDES) program. You propose to bury approximately 98 feet of the pipe within Section 10 waters of the Tar River for the purpose of installing the 6-inch discharge pipe. Trench excavation is approximately 2 feet wide by 3 feet deep. The terminal end of the pipe will be exposed, and extend approximately 2 feet into the waters of the Tar River. Your work is authorized by this nationwide permit and the enclosed general permit provided it is accomplished in strict accordance with the enclosed conditions. Please read the enclosed general permit to prevent an unintentional violation of Federal law. The aforementioned permits do not relieve you of the responsibility to obtain any required State or local approval. i -2- This verification will be valid for 2 years from the date of this letter unless the nationwide authorization is modified, reissued, or revoked. Also, this verification will remain valid for the 2 years if, during that period, the nationwide permit authorization is reissued without modification or the activity complies with any subsequent modification of the nationwide permit authorization. If during the 2 years, the nationwide permit authorization expires or is suspended or revoked, or is modified, such that the activity would no longer comply with the terms and conditions of the nationwide permit, activities which have commenced (i.e., are under construction) or are under contract to commence in reliance upon the nationwide permit will remain authorized provided the activity is completed within 12 months of the date of the nationwide permit's expiration, modification or revocation, unless discretionary authority has been exercised on a case-by-case basis to modify, suspend, or revoke the authorization.
